What's The Definition Of Moderate gale?

moderate gale in American English
a wind whose speed is 32 to 38 miles per hour
noun: a wind of 32–38 mph (14–17 m/ sec)

moderate gale in British English
noun: a gale of force seven on the Beaufort scale, capable of swaying trees
